Output 149de8001c0f6b31fe2b3f5f9b834ad2607225d2f7e03f7278924af1ed9a60d0:0

value
2592581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dc511f23403d4b8b12a17ed03b3059f4157e40d OP_EQUAL
address
3LT2XYFtFzTkJhNMfg3jaSepDonpKvub9H
transaction
149de8001c0f6b31fe2b3f5f9b834ad2607225d2f7e03f7278924af1ed9a60d0
confirmations
327930
spent
true